LeBron James is making a surprise move to the Philadelphia 76ers on a two-year, $8M deal with a player option — his final run with a new team after Miami passed. Meanwhile, Miami’s offseason is far from quiet: they’ve already landed Giannis Antetokounmpo in a blockbuster trade and are now eyeing veteran scorers like Bradley Beal, 33, who’s recovering from a hip fracture and could sign a veteran minimum deal. With Khris Middleton gone to Milwaukee, Beal might be Miami’s next low-cost, high-impact addition as they build around their new superstar.
